    Debated this myself up until I talked to my Line-X dealer here. I'm going to have them Line-X'd but I was thinking about going premium and color matching my Silver truck. He told me the silver looks like shit on the Line-X, it never comes out quite "right" and even worse in metallic so that clenched it for me i'll just have them done in black Line-X. The other big reason I won't color match is just like on my Tacoma the fender flares are a magnet for asshats to scratch. I'll be doing the flares when I get them, front and rear bumper (rear bumper got tagged already and buffing it out went through the chrome LMFAO so not expected) and my side steps in Line-X.
